The 2019 Indoor Football League season was the eleventh of the Indoor Football League (IFL). The league played this season with ten teams, up from six the previous season, by adding two expansion teams and two teams from Champions Indoor Football.
The top six teams made the IFL playoffs, with the first round consisting of the top two seeds earning byes, the third seed hosting the sixth seed, and the fourth hosting the fifth seed. In the semifinals, the top seed hosted the lower remaining seed and the second hosting the higher-seeded winner from the first round. The semifinal winners met in the 2019 United Bowl on the weekend of July 13.[1]
